Location: Marine projects in Glasgow
Contract Type: Long-term, ongoing work
Shifts: Day shifts, night shifts, mid-week & weekend overtime available
Roles & Pay Rates- Industrial Painters: £19.46 - £38.92 per hour (PAYE)
- Blasters/Sprayers: £20.73 - £41.46 per hour (PAYE)
- Supervisors/Inspectors: £22.00 - £44.00 per hour (PAYE)
- Lodge Allowance: To be agreed
- Payment Options: CIS available - rates to be confirmed.
- Marine Experience: Proven experience in marine projects is essential
- Certifications: Valid TTP or ICATS card required
- Clearance & Testing: All applicants must be able to obtain security clearance and pass regular drug & alcohol tests
